How to clear DNS cache on phone

“`html
In our increasingly connected world, smartphones have become vital tools for communication, information access, and entertainment. However, just like computers, mobile devices can run into issues that hinder their performance. One common culprit is the DNS (Domain Name System) cache. Understanding how to clear DNS cache on phone can significantly improve your browsing experience and help troubleshoot connectivity issues. This article will outline what DNS caching is, why it matters, and provide a step-by-step guide for clearing the DNS cache on various phones.
1. What is DNS and Why is it Important?
The Domain Name System (DNS) is essentially the internet’s phonebook. It translates user-friendly domain names like www.example.com into IP addresses that are necessary for locating and identifying devices on a network. Without DNS, you would have to remember complex numerical addresses to access websites.
When you type a URL into your phone’s browser, the DNS server retrieves the corresponding IP address. To speed up this process, devices store recent queries in a DNS cache. This means that when you revisit a website, your device can retrieve the stored IP address rather than querying the DNS server again, which can lead to faster loading times. However, if the cached information is outdated or incorrect, it can cause problems like failed connections or outdated content.
2. Common Issues Linked to DNS Cache
As convenient as the DNS cache may be, it can occasionally lead to issues. One of the most common problems is encountering a DNS_PROBE_FINISHED_NXDOMAIN error. This error indicates that the DNS query did not return any results. It can be caused by a variety of factors, including expired cache entries, incorrect DNS configurations, or issues with the DNS servers themselves.
Another issue could be accessing outdated content. If a website has recently changed its server or IP address, your phone may still be trying to access the old data stored in the DNS cache, leading to loading errors or outdated pages. Clearing the cache can help resolve these issues and ensure you’re accessing the most current information available.
3. How to Clear DNS Cache on Android Phones
For Android users, the process of clearing the DNS cache can vary slightly depending on the version of the operating system and the specific device model. However, the general steps are fairly consistent. Here’s how to do it:
- Clear App Cache: Go to Settings > Apps > Google Chrome (or your preferred browser). Tap on Storage > Clear Cache. This action clears the cache for that specific app.
- Clear System Cache: Restart the phone in recovery mode. Depending on your phone, press and hold the Power + Volume Up + Home buttons until the recovery menu appears. Use the volume buttons to navigate to Wipe Cache Partition and select it.
- Reset Network Settings: Go to Settings > System > Reset options > Reset Wi-Fi, mobile & Bluetooth. This will reset all network settings, including the DNS cache.
Note that resetting network settings will erase saved Wi-Fi networks and Bluetooth pairings, so you’ll need to reconnect afterward.
4. How to Clear DNS Cache on iPhones
iPhone users can also clear the DNS cache easily with a few simple steps. Here’s a straightforward method to do it:
- Restart the Device: A simple restart can clear temporary DNS cache entries. Hold the side button and the volume button until the slider appears, then slide to power off.
- Reset Network Settings: Navigate to Settings > General > Transfer or Reset iPhone > Reset > Reset Network Settings. This will clear all network-related data, including the DNS cache.
- Change DNS Settings: Go to Settings > Wi-Fi. Tap the info icon next to your connected network and scroll down to Configure DNS. Change it from Automatic to Manual, then enter a different DNS server (like Google’s 8.8.8.8).
Changing the DNS settings can sometimes provide a more stable connection if the default DNS servers are experiencing issues.
5. The Benefits of Clearing DNS Cache
Clearing the DNS cache can lead to numerous benefits, especially if you’re experiencing connectivity issues. First and foremost, it can resolve loading errors and allow you to access websites that were previously unreachable. This can be particularly helpful if a site has migrated to a new server but your device still tries to connect to the old IP address.
Additionally, clearing the cache can help improve your browsing speed. By refreshing the DNS information, your phone may retrieve more optimized routes for connecting to websites, resulting in quicker load times. Furthermore, it can also reduce security risks; outdated cache entries may lead to phishing pages if a website’s IP address changes. (See: Overview of Domain Name System.)
6. How Often Should You Clear DNS Cache?
There’s no fixed rule for how often you should clear DNS cache on phone, but consider doing it if you start experiencing connectivity problems. Regularly clearing your cache can be beneficial if you frequently visit sites that change addresses or if you use apps that rely on real-time data.
If you’re a developer or frequently test websites, clearing the cache might need to be done even more often to ensure you’re seeing the most current version of pages. For most everyday users, however, a periodic clean-up—say once a month or whenever you encounter issues—should suffice.
7. Alternative Solutions to DNS Issues
If clearing the DNS cache doesn’t resolve your issues, there are alternative solutions to consider. One effective method is to change your DNS provider. Opting for a public DNS service like Google DNS or Cloudflare DNS can yield better performance and increased reliability compared to your Internet Service Provider’s (ISP) default DNS.
To change your DNS settings, you can follow the steps outlined in the previous sections for both Android and iPhone. After switching to a public DNS, give your device a moment to update before testing the connection again. You might find that websites load faster and more reliably.
8. Using Third-Party Apps to Manage DNS Cache
For those who prefer a more automated approach, there are third-party applications available that can manage DNS caches. Apps like DNS Changer allow users to change their DNS settings without diving into the device settings. This can streamline the process and make it easier for non-tech savvy users.
Moreover, some apps offer additional features like monitoring DNS queries, helping users identify potential security risks or performance issues. Just be sure to choose reputable apps from trusted sources, as using poorly-reviewed apps can expose your device to unwanted risks.
9. Understanding the DNS Cache Lifecycle
It’s helpful to understand the lifecycle of a DNS cache to appreciate its role better. When you first visit a website, your device queries the DNS server to translate the domain into an IP address. This IP address is then stored in your DNS cache for a predetermined duration, known as the Time to Live (TTL).
The TTL is set by the authoritative DNS server for the domain and can vary significantly from seconds to days. After the TTL expires, the cached entry is purged, which prompts the device to re-query the DNS server the next time you visit the site. Depending on the frequency of your internet use, this can mean that many of your commonly visited sites are stored in your cache, improving load times and reducing data usage.
10. Expert Perspectives on DNS Caching
Experts in the field of networking emphasize the importance of DNS caching as a balancing act between speed and accuracy. According to John Doe, a network engineer with over a decade of experience, “Caching is essential for maintaining speed in our fast-paced internet environment, but outdated cache can lead to significant issues.” This perspective underscores why clearing the DNS cache is a necessary skill for users wanting to maintain optimal performance.
Another expert, Jane Smith, a cybersecurity analyst, points out the security implications of outdated DNS cache entries. “Phishing attacks can occur when a user unknowingly connects to a malicious site with a changed IP address. Regularly clearing the cache reduces this risk, ensuring users remain connected to legitimate services.”
11. DNS Cache Clearing and Privacy Concerns
Privacy is another significant reason to consider clearing your DNS cache. When you visit websites, your DNS queries can be recorded and potentially sold to advertisers or used for tracking purposes. This can lead to a loss of privacy, especially if you’re accessing sensitive information.
By clearing your DNS cache, you’re not just troubleshooting performance; you’re also taking a step towards better privacy management. If you’re concerned about how your data is used, consider using privacy-focused DNS providers, such as Cloudflare or OpenDNS, which are designed to keep your browsing habits more secure.
12. Frequently Asked Questions (FAQ)
What does it mean to clear the DNS cache on my phone?
Clearing the DNS cache on your phone means deleting the stored records of previously visited websites, forcing your device to retrieve fresh data the next time you access those sites. This helps in resolving connectivity issues and ensures you’re accessing the most current version of a website. (See: CDC information on DNS.)
Do I need to clear the DNS cache frequently?
It’s not necessary to clear your DNS cache regularly unless you’re experiencing issues like loading errors or outdated content. If everything is functioning smoothly, a monthly check-up should suffice.
Will clearing the DNS cache erase my browsing history?
No, clearing the DNS cache will not erase your browsing history. It only removes the temporary DNS records stored on your device. Your actual history of visited sites remains intact.
Can I use a VPN to avoid DNS caching issues?
Yes, using a VPN can help circumvent some DNS caching issues as it routes your internet traffic through secure servers, often reducing reliance on your ISP’s DNS servers. This can help improve privacy and potentially enhance connection speed.
How can I tell if I need to clear my DNS cache?
If you notice errors like DNS_PROBE_FINISHED_NXDOMAIN, loading issues on specific websites, or if you’re being redirected to unexpected pages, it might be time to clear your DNS cache. Frequent attempts to access a site that has recently changed its address can also be a sign.
Is it safe to use third-party DNS services?
Generally, reputable third-party DNS services like Google DNS, Cloudflare, or OpenDNS are safe to use. They often offer improved speed and security compared to your ISP’s DNS. Just make sure to read reviews and ensure you’re using a trusted service.
13. Comparing Public DNS Providers
If you’re considering switching your DNS provider, it’s useful to compare the most popular public DNS options. For example, Google DNS, known for its speed and reliability, uses the IP addresses 8.8.8.8 and 8.8.4.4, while Cloudflare DNS boasts privacy and speed, utilizing 1.1.1.1 and 1.0.0.1. OpenDNS is another strong contender, offering enhanced security features and customizable filtering.
Statistics show that switching to a public DNS can enhance your browsing experience. A study by DNSPerf found that Google DNS is one of the fastest DNS services, consistently ranking in the top three for speed. Meanwhile, Cloudflare DNS has been recognized for its zero-logging policy, ensuring that your browsing history remains private.
Choosing the right public DNS can largely depend on your priorities. If speed is your primary concern, Google DNS may be the best fit. If privacy is paramount, Cloudflare’s offerings might be more appealing. OpenDNS can be an excellent choice for families seeking more control over web content access.
14. Advanced DNS Settings You Can Modify
In addition to clearing the DNS cache, there are several advanced DNS settings that users can modify to optimize their phone’s internet experience. For example, one option is to enable DNS over HTTPS (DoH). This feature encrypts your DNS queries, adding a layer of security by preventing eavesdropping and man-in-the-middle attacks.
Another advanced option is to set custom DNS servers directly in your network settings. This can be particularly useful if you frequently use different networks (like home Wi-Fi and public hotspots) that may not have reliable DNS services. By setting a preferred DNS, your phone will always use that server first, potentially improving reliability and speed.
For Android users, you can find these settings under Wi-Fi preferences. On iPhone, it’s found in the respective Wi-Fi network settings. Make sure to research the DNS settings that best fit your needs before making changes. (See: New York Times explanation of DNS.)
15. Impact of DNS on Mobile Applications
The impact of DNS on mobile applications is often underestimated. Many popular apps rely on internet connectivity and DNS functionality to retrieve data. If your phone’s DNS cache is outdated, you may find that apps take longer to load or even fail to connect altogether.
For instance, streaming services like Netflix or Spotify may face buffering or loading issues if the DNS cache is stale. Users may experience delays as their devices struggle to resolve the IP address for the service they want to access. Clearing the DNS cache can mitigate these issues, leading to a smoother user experience.
In some cases, apps may also cache DNS entries independently, leading to further complications. If you’re facing continuous issues with a particular app, it may help to clear both the app cache and your device’s DNS cache, ensuring that you’re not working with outdated information.
16. Common Misconceptions About DNS Cache
Several misconceptions surround the concept of DNS cache that can lead to confusion. One common myth is that clearing DNS cache will significantly speed up your overall internet connection. While it can resolve specific issues related to outdated entries, it does not inherently boost your internet speed.
Another misconception is that DNS cache clearing is a one-time fix. In reality, it’s a maintenance task that may need to be performed regularly, especially if you frequently encounter DNS-related errors or are a heavy internet user.
Finally, some users believe that using public DNS automatically guarantees better security. While it can improve your browsing experience and privacy, it’s crucial to combine this with other security practices like using a VPN and ensuring that your devices are up-to-date with the latest security patches.
17. Final Thoughts on DNS Cache Management
Understanding how to clear DNS cache on phone is essential for maintaining optimal performance and connectivity. By regularly clearing your cache and knowing how to troubleshoot DNS issues, you can greatly enhance your browsing experience. Whether you’re an average user or a tech enthusiast, staying on top of these practices can save you time and frustration.
Regularly revisiting and refreshing your network settings is not just good practice; it’s a proactive measure to ensure you’re always connected to the most current and relevant data. So, next time you encounter a browsing hiccup, remember that a simple DNS cache clear might just be the remedy you need!
“`
Trending Now
Frequently Asked Questions
What does clearing DNS cache do on a phone?
Clearing the DNS cache on your phone removes stored IP addresses and domain names, allowing your device to fetch the latest information from DNS servers. This can resolve connectivity issues, speed up browsing, and ensure you access the most recent versions of websites.
How do I clear DNS cache on Android?
To clear DNS cache on Android, go to Settings > Apps > Show system apps > Google Play Services > Storage. Then, tap on 'Clear Cache'. Alternatively, restarting the device or toggling Airplane mode can also refresh the DNS cache.
How do I clear DNS cache on iPhone?
To clear the DNS cache on an iPhone, you can reset network settings by going to Settings > General > Reset > Reset Network Settings. This will clear all network-related caches, including DNS.
What are the common DNS cache issues on mobile devices?
Common DNS cache issues on mobile devices include the DNS_PROBE_FINISHED_NXDOMAIN error, which indicates that the DNS query returned no results, and problems accessing outdated content due to cached IP addresses pointing to old servers.
Why is it important to clear DNS cache regularly?
Clearing DNS cache regularly is important to ensure that your device accesses the most accurate and up-to-date website information. It helps prevent connectivity issues and improves overall browsing performance by eliminating outdated or incorrect cached data.
Agree or disagree? Drop a comment and tell us what you think.



